City of Ponca City Reminds You-“Flushable” Isn’t Flushable

Products labeled as “flushable wipes” may seem convenient—but they can cause serious and costly problems. Unlike toilet paper, these wipes do not break down properly in the sewer system. Instead, they can clog pipes, damage pumps, and contribute to sewer backups. These issues don’t just affect the City’s infrastructure—they can also impact your home, leading... Read More.

Senate Unanimously Approves Bill Requiring GPS Tracking for Violent Domestic Abusers

OKLAHOMA CITY – The Oklahoma Senate on Tuesday unanimously approved legislation from Sen. Bill Coleman, R-Ponca City, to require the state to utilize GPS technology to protect victims of domestic violence in egregious abuse cases. In a 47-0 vote, the Senate passed Senate Bill 1325, which requires GPS monitoring for domestic violence defendants who have had... Read More.
